Cherry is good firewood, and most people buy it for the wrong reason. It is not a top-tier primary-heating or overnight wood, and if you are trying to hold a house through a January cold snap, oak or hickory will serve you better. What cherry does better than almost anything else is make a fire worth sitting in front of, and it does one thing nobody talks about: it is ready to burn long before your oak is.

Heat output is measured in BTUs per cord, and cherry lands in the middle of the hardwood range at roughly 20.4 million, or 20 to 21 million depending on the forestry table you read. That is real, usable heat. It is not oak. Here is where cherry sits against the other species we process:
| Species | BTU per Cord | Density | Heat Rating |
|---|---|---|---|
| Hickory | 27.7 million | Very dense | Premium |
| Oak (White) | 26.4 million | Dense | Premium |
| Oak (Red) | 24.6 million | Dense | Excellent |
| Maple (Hard) | 23.9 million | Dense | Excellent |
| Ash | 23.6 million | Dense | Excellent |
| Birch (Yellow) | 21.8 million | Medium-dense | Good |
| Cherry | 20.4 million | Medium-dense | Good |
BTU values are published averages from forestry sources including the USDA Forest Service and university extension programs. Actual output varies with growing conditions, density, and moisture content at the time of burning.
You will occasionally see cherry described as producing heat similar to oak. It does not. The gap is 4 to 9 million BTU per cord depending on which oak you compare against, and you will feel it in a cold room.
Weight tells the same story. Our Wisconsin black cherry runs about 3,800 to 4,000 pounds per cord green, and 3,000 to 3,200 pounds per cord of firewood once it leaves our kilns at 15% moisture. White oak lands around 4,200 to 4,400 pounds dried. Less dry wood mass per cord is the main reason cherry produces fewer BTUs per cord than denser woods such as oak.
Properly split and stored cherry firewood commonly reaches burnable moisture in 6 to 12 months, considerably sooner than oak. This is the single most misunderstood thing about cherry, and it is the reason it deserves a place in a woodpile even if you heat primarily with something denser.
You will find guidance online putting cherry at 12 to 24 months. That is oak's timeline applied to the wrong species. Oak is one of the wettest hardwoods when cut and one of the slowest to give that water up. Our kiln records and yard experience consistently show properly split black cherry reaching the target moisture considerably sooner than oak.
Cherry split and properly stacked in March can often be ready by late fall. Not as good as kiln-dried, but it will burn. Oak from the same season may miss that first winter entirely and commonly needs 12 to 24 months.
Conditions matter as much as the calendar. Air, sun, and getting the wood up off the ground do the work, so that 6 to 12 month window assumes you are storing the wood properly. A stack in a shaded, damp corner behind a shed will not hit 6 months no matter the species. For timelines by species and split size, see our guide on how long firewood takes to season.
Do not judge readiness by the calendar. Split a piece and test the fresh face with a moisture meter, not the weathered outside, which reads misleadingly low. Air-dried firewood should be under 20% before you burn it, which lines up with EPA moisture meter guidance.

This is where most people lose a season, and cherry is the species it happens to most. Water leaves a log through the cut ends, not through the sides, because bark seals the outside. A whole round has two small exits. Split that same round and you open the entire length of the face. Splitting is not something you do after the wood dries, it is what starts the wood drying.
Cherry makes this trap worse than most species. Cherry bark stays on well. It does not shed or break apart the way oak bark does as it dries, so a cherry log holds its seal longer. Split cherry is one of the faster woods in the yard. Cherry left in the round is one of the slower ones. Same tree, opposite answer, decided entirely by whether a splitter touched it.
We have cherry sitting on our lot right now that came off the landing 12 to 18 months ago. The ends are grey, the bark is checked, and it looks every bit like seasoned wood. Run it through the processor and test a fresh face and it reads high 20s to low 30s. Eighteen months of weather bought that log almost nothing, because almost none of it was ever exposed.


In our Wisconsin operation, cherry firewood means black cherry, Prunus serotina, also commonly called wild cherry. Same tree, two names, which is worth knowing if you have been told you have wild cherry on your property and were not sure whether it was worth cutting. It is.
Other trees sold or described as cherry may be different Prunus species. Sweet cherry, sour cherry, chokecherry, and old orchard trees all burn, and orchard wood is a well-regarded smoking wood. They just will not have exactly the same density or burn characteristics as the black cherry these numbers come from.

One thing before you fire up the saw: a large, straight, clear cherry trunk may be worth more standing than split. Black cherry is furniture-grade lumber, prized for cabinetry and veneer, and a good log is worth real money to a sawmill. Crooked stems and branch wood are your firewood. Make that call before you buck it into stove lengths, because you cannot undo the cut.
This is the part that keeps people coming back for cherry, and it is the part every other firewood article skips.
The blue flame. Cherry often shows more visible blue around its flames than many common firewoods. Blue light in a fire comes from burning gases above the wood rather than the wood itself, and cherry's particular mixture of volatile compounds and minerals may make that color more noticeable, especially with good airflow and little yellow soot. You have seen the color before: it is the same blue at the base of a flame or on a lighter. In an open fireplace with good draw, cherry shows it clearly. Even in a closed stove, where you normally get a solid orange glow, cherry throws more of a blue cast.
The crackle. Cherry has a noticeably more distinctive crackle and pop than oak, and most people count that as a feature. Worth being precise here, because most firewood guides blur two different things together: crackling is the sound, ember throwing is the safety concern. Cherry crackles audibly more than oak but is not a spitter the way pine or cedar is. Use a screen on an open hearth, same as any fruitwood, and you are fine.
Coals. Better than the BTU number suggests. Cherry builds a workable coal bed that holds heat after the flames drop and outlasts a lighter wood like soft maple. It will not match oak or hickory overnight, but it does not quit the moment the flames die either.
Smoke. Low, when the wood is properly dry, which is exactly why cherry works indoors. At 15% moisture, it lights readily with proper kindling and settles into a clean fire.
Ash. Moderate. In our experience cherry leaves a little more firebox residue than longer-burning woods like oak or hickory, whose sustained coal beds give more of the remaining wood time to burn down. It is not an unusually ashy firewood, and it is not something customers complain about.
After enough years of taking orders, the pattern is clear, and it splits the year in half.
Summer belongs to the cooks. Homeowner demand drops off almost entirely once the weather turns warm, and that is the right call. Cherry costs more than mixed hardwood, and burning a premium wood outdoors where it will not last as long or throw as much heat as oak is a waste of money. Summer volume goes to smoking: backyard cooks, catering companies, and the portable smoker trucks that run events all season.
Fall and winter belong to homeowners. Once the temperature drops, cherry becomes one of our busiest single-species orders. People buy it for the smell, the blue flame, and the way the wood looks stacked in a rack next to a fireplace. It looks expensive because it is, and there is nothing wrong with that being part of the appeal. The moderate heat is a feature here too: a fireplace loaded with cherry warms a room without driving everyone out of it, which is a real complaint we hear about hotter woods in small spaces.
Mixing. For anyone burning regularly: cherry to light and build the fire, then oak or hickory on top to hold it. Cherry catches fast and burns clean, which makes it a better starter than a dense split that fights you for twenty minutes.
When cherry is the wrong call. Sub-zero nights when you need maximum output. Primary wood heat with a stove running daily. Tight storage where you have room for one species and it needs to be the one doing the most work. In all three cases, buy oak.
Cherry is best known for pork and poultry. The smoke is mild and slightly sweet, and it lays down a deep mahogany color that is most of the reason cooks reach for it.
Here is a distinction most people never encounter. Smoke Shack in Milwaukee, one of the wood-fired restaurants we supply, buys green cherry from us on purpose for its baby back ribs. Green wood produces more smoke, and in controlled commercial smoking equipment that is exactly what they want. Homeowners buy the opposite: kiln-dried cherry at 15% for a clean, low-smoke burn. Same species, opposite specification, opposite reasons.
That is a commercial practice in purpose-built equipment, not a recommendation for your fireplace. For home burning, dry wood is always the answer. For pairings by protein and dish, see our cooking wood guide with protein pairing chart.

For heat and burn time, oak. It produces 24.6 to 26.4 million BTU per cord against cherry's 20.4 million, and it holds coals far longer. For easy lighting, clean burning, and aroma, cherry wins. Most people who burn regularly keep both and use each for what it does well.
Properly split and stored cherry commonly reaches burnable moisture in 6 to 12 months, considerably sooner than oak's 12 to 24 months. In our experience, properly split and stored black cherry dries considerably faster than oak. Always test a freshly split face and look for moisture below 20%.
Moderate heat is the main one. At 20.4 million BTU per cord, cherry will not hold a fire overnight the way oak or hickory will. It crackles more than oak, so an open fireplace wants a screen. It produces a moderate amount of ash and, in our experience, leaves slightly more firebox residue than longer-burning woods such as oak or hickory. It also costs more than mixed hardwood.
Yes. Cherry is safe to burn in fireplaces, wood stoves, and outdoor fire pits, and it is one of the most popular woods for smoking pork and poultry. Kiln-dried cherry has been heat-treated, which kills insects and mold, so it is safe to stack indoors when kept dry. As with any species, never burn wood that has been painted, stained, glued, or pressure-treated.
Cherry burns at moderate heat, not high heat. Roughly 20.4 million BTU per cord puts it in the middle of the hardwood range alongside birch. That is an advantage indoors, where a hotter wood can make a small room uncomfortable, and a disadvantage if wood is your primary heat source.
Crackling comes from pockets of moisture and gas expanding inside the wood and releasing suddenly. Cherry has a distinctive crackle, more than oak, and most people consider it part of the appeal. That is different from throwing embers: cherry is not a spitter the way pine or cedar is.
Yes. Cherry is one of the most popular smoking woods for pork and poultry, delivering mild, slightly sweet smoke and a deep mahogany color on the finished meat. It pairs well with stronger woods like hickory or oak when you want more depth. See our cooking wood guide for pairings by protein and dish.
